Good news ! The cooling system is working and I got the charging system working also. The next thing I going to work on is the shifter and cables. The car was originally a auto so I already put in the clutch pedal and master cylinder. I also picked up cables from a manual fiero. I'm looking for a manual shifter to modify for this project, it doesn't have to be in good condition because it will be rebuilt and modified. So if anyone has a spare shifter please let me know. Here are some pics of the bundle of snakes (headers) in the car.





Notice the clear tube with antifreeze and a big air bubble coming out of the throttle body, I did this to see the burping process,. When the engine is running these bubbles go to the surge tank, eventually all the bubbles will go away. Then just open the surge tank and let all those nasty air bubbles escape.

Beautiful!! How much of a pain was it to get the Audi trans and gm motor to bolt up because I would love to use the 3.8 v6 but I was going for an Audi v6 just so I don't need an adapter or special starter... What do you think?
Nebraska JAN 06, 09:34 PM
What I think your saying is that you want to connect a 3800 to a Audi transmission, right ? if that is the case the Kennedy Engineering sells the adapter for that combo. You can Google them. That was the adapter I started with because the Northstar and 3800 have the same transmission bolt pattern. Hope that helps.
